The University of Delhi has officially launched the postgraduate admission process for the 2026-27 academic session through the Common Seat Allocation System for Postgraduate Programmes. The CSAS-PG 2026 registration window opened on May 16, 2026, and candidates can submit their applications until June 7, 2026, at 11:59 PM. All PG admissions will be based entirely on CUET PG 2026 scores.
Candidates must register separately on the CSAS-PG portal even if they appeared for CUET PG 2026. Without this registration, their admission applications will not be processed. Delhi University has integrated DigiLocker and API Setu systems this year, allowing candidate details such as CUET scores, name, category, and date of birth to be auto-fetched digitally.
The NTA released the CUET PG 2026 result on April 24. General and OBC-NCL category candidates need a minimum of 50 percent marks in their qualifying degree, while SC, ST, and PwD candidates require 45 percent. Students should select course and college preferences carefully during registration, as seat allocation will depend on merit and preference order.
